The Program Supervisor of Intact Family Services is a critical
member of both the region’s child welfare team, as well as the
agency’s broader leadership team, working collaboratively within
and across programs to ensure a relentless focus on keeping
children safe and supporting families. The Intact Family Services
program provides families with intensive, trauma-informed case
management services using Solution-Based Casework (SBC), an
evidence-informed casework model of partnering with families to
help them reach their goals. As the Program Supervisor, you will
provide reflective supervision to Intact Specialists, and be a
vocal advocate for continuous program evaluation and improvement,
all with the goal of helping children and families thrive.
